#c6c6a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6c6a2 is composed of 77.6% red, 77.6%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.2%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 24% and a lightness of 70.6%. #c6c6a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8d8d45.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#c6c6a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040403 is the darkest color, while #fafa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6c6a2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b5b3 is the less saturated color, while #fafa6e is the most saturated one.
